Synchronization abstraction in the BETA programming language
Summary: This paper argues that synchronization of processes need not be part of the core of a programming language, but that they can just as well be built from existing abstractions -- provided these are sufficiently flexible and general. BETA's notion of patterns meets these requirements and we demonstrate the validity of our claims within this ...

Abstraction and Modularization in the BETA Programming Language
One of the characteristics of BETA is the unification of abstraction mechanisms such as class, procedure, process type, generic class, interface, etc. into one abstraction mechanism: the pattern. In addition to keeping the language small, the unification has given a systematic treatment of all abstraction mechanisms and lead to a number of new ...
